I have taken thousands of photos at car shows, and there many things which annoy me from a photographer's standpoint. ...At the top of the list is the inevitable sign in the windshield. I have asked the owners to remove them on occasion, and they are usually cooperative. They are normally pleased that you are photographing their "baby". Other annoyances are "too many hoods are up", "lighting is too harsh, amplifying reflections, also pushing the limits of your camera's dynamic range", " and "too many people". An ultra wide angle lens is very helpful for getting over the latter problem. There are also a few more annoyances that get under my skin at car shows. That being said, car shows remain one of my
